But the sentiment that will ultimately define the 2012 season is not one centered on an enduring dynasty, but rather the delight experienced in welcoming a new giant slayer to the party.
It took more than one stone for this David to slay his Goliath. Trailing 5-0 as they entered the fifth inning, Dalton Road plated seven runs and held on defensively for the remaining two innings to gain (what this reporter believes to be) their first league championship. Somewhere Bryce Brackett was smiling.
And thus ends the 2012 campaign, a season marked by a new board and relatively little controversy. Based on the final results, some teams will move up to Division A, and some will move down to Division B, but on this night, the camaraderie enjoyed by the more than 200 men who participate in the league took center stage.
